In this October 2012 interview, MAJ Richard Bell, US Army, Field Artillery (FA); discusses his deployment to Iraq as a battalion direction officer, fire support officer and assistant operations officer for 2-12 Field Artillery, 4th Brigade, 2nd Infantry Division (ID) in 2007 through 2008 in support of Operation Iraqi Freedom (OIF). MAJ Bell talks about his missions and operations while in country. He describes his living quarters and meals and notes the changes from his first deployment to his last deployment. He recalls a special memory in Hussoniyah and details his mission there. He describes the interaction he had with the Iraqi Army and Iraqi police and talks about how the Iraqis reacted to recommendations. MAJ Bell defines his battalion's successes and closes his interview by stating, "I learned not to necessarily think outside the box, but I realized how big the box was."
